Catalogue entry
N06255 CROUCHING WOMAN c. 1919
Inscr. ‘Wyndham Lewis’ b.l.
Black chalk and wash, 11×15 (28×38).
Purchased from the Mayor Gallery (Cleve Fund) 1955.
Coll: Purchased by Richard Wyndham from the artist c.
1922; Mayor Gallery 1946.
Exh: Redfern Gallery, May 1949 (51).
The drawing can be dated c. 1919 from a comparison with the ‘Red Nude’ and ‘Blue Nude’, both signed and dated 1919 (Mayor Gallery and Leeds respectively; exh. Tate Gallery, July–August 1956 (51 and 52)).
Published in:
Mary Chamot, Dennis Farr and Martin Butlin, The Modern British Paintings, Drawings and Sculpture, London 1964, I
